history
Spectrum Fine Cabinetry was founded in 1976 as a family business in suburban New York by Steven Nakash, an accomplished cabinetmaker with a vision: to assemble a team with unrivaled technical expertise, held to the highest production standards. Nakash’s vision was realized for many years through the output of a large, state-of-the-art production facility in Long Island. Steered by the founder’s commitment to excellence, in 2006 Spectrum shifted production to Pordenone, Italy, as demand increased for high-end finishes of European design.
Since that time, Spectrum become a leader and innovator in custom cabinetry and soon became the resource of choice for many of the best interior designers, builders, and developers in the US. Driven by their father’s passionate vision, Steven’s sons Brian and Michael joined the business to uphold the value of craftsmanship that Steven had established. While Brian manages New York projects, Michael expanded the family business to South Florida, determined to infuse Spectrum Fine Cabinetry’s unparalleled craftsmanship into the region’s most luxurious buildings. Their dedication to excellence and innovation has elevated the art of cabinetry, making a lasting impact on South Florida’s architectural landscape.

our sustainability
efforts
Sven’s gleaming, curved façade rises in Long Island City and reflects the heart of the neighborhood. Designed by Handel Architects, the tower’s 71 stories combine the beauty of clean design with remarkable environmental achievements. Sven is the tallest building in the US to achieve LEEDv4 Platinum Level Certification, the highest attainable level. Spectrum ensured all cabinets were made from no-added urea formaldehyde substrates, are free from harmful chemicals. Cabinets were independently tested for compliance with indoor air quality standards using the ANSI/BIFMA M7.1 Private Office method. All hardware were RoHS compliant, and the glues varnishes were Greenguard Gold Certified.
MADE IN ITALY
Located within the esteemed Italian furniture sector, our production units provide us with the invaluable opportunity to collaborate closely with exceptional artisans and specialized workshops.
Spectrum’s master craftsmen apply hand finishing techniques and joinery methods that have been passed down and perfected through generations, while targeted utilization of technology ensures a remarkable degree of consistency and a high level of quality assurance.
